News summary

Denny Hamlin achieved a significant milestone with his first NASCAR Cup Series victory at Martinsville since 2015, leading 274 of 400 laps and tying Rusty Wallace for 11th on the all-time win list. This win marked Hamlin's 55th career victory, breaking a 31-race winless streak. Regular season points leader William Byron faced a setback, finishing 22nd and seeing his lead shrink to just 16 points over Kyle Larson. The race also saw Erik Jones disqualified for failing to meet minimum weight requirements, impacting his standing. In the NASCAR Xfinity Series, Austin Hill clinched a win after a chaotic finish, while in the Truck Series, Daniel Hemric secured his first victory. The next races are scheduled for Darlington Raceway, with the Goodyear 400 on April 6 and the Sport Clips Haircuts VFW 200 on April 5.
